Contemporary earthenware platter by noted Oribe artist Tamaoki Yasuo. Yasuo, a sub-chairman of the Mino Ceramic Art Society, was born in Tajimi City in 1941, and studied under master Koubei Kato. This beautiful platter features an asymmetrical shape with swirling shades of pale blue, as well as the traditional Oribe green and off-white glazes. It measures roughly 6 3/4 inches square and stands 1 1/2 inches. It bears Yasuo's signature on the bottom, and is in perfect condition. ...click for details

Contemporary earthenware platter by noted Oribe artist Tamaoki Yasuo. Yasuo, a sub-chairman of the Mino Ceramic Art Society, was born in Tajimi City in 1941, and studied under master Koubei Kato. This beautiful platter features a slightly asymmetrical shape, with an inlaid pattern of graceful rice stalks in a field of stunning green glaze.
